Concurrent Investment Advisors LLC Buys New Shares in Huntington Bancshares Incorporated $HBAN

Concurrent Investment Advisors LLC purchased a new stake in shares of Huntington Bancshares Incorporated (NASDAQ:HBANFree Report) during the fourth quarter, according to the company in its most recent disclosure with the Securities & Exchange Commission. The institutional investor purchased 48,785 shares of the bank’s stock, valued at approximately $846,000.

Huntington Bancshares Stock Performance

NASDAQ HBAN opened at $16.63 on Friday. The company has a market cap of $33.87 billion, a P/E ratio of 12.79, a PEG ratio of 0.77 and a beta of 0.96. The company has a fifty day simple moving average of $16.23 and a 200 day simple moving average of $16.72. The company has a current ratio of 0.93, a quick ratio of 0.92 and a debt-to-equity ratio of 0.73. Huntington Bancshares Incorporated has a 12-month low of $14.78 and a 12-month high of $19.45.

Huntington Bancshares (NASDAQ:HBANGet Free Report) last released its quarterly earnings data on Thursday, April 23rd. The bank reported $0.37 earnings per share for the quarter, topping the consensus estimate of $0.16 by $0.21. The firm had revenue of $2.59 billion for the quarter, compared to the consensus estimate of $2.57 billion. Huntington Bancshares had a net margin of 16.63% and a return on equity of 11.42%. During the same quarter in the prior year, the company posted $0.34 earnings per share. Sell-side analysts predict that Huntington Bancshares Incorporated will post 1.61 earnings per share for the current fiscal year.

Huntington Bancshares Announces Dividend

The firm also recently declared a quarterly dividend, which will be paid on Wednesday, July 1st. Investors of record on Wednesday, June 17th will be given a $0.155 dividend. The ex-dividend date of this dividend is Wednesday, June 17th. This represents a $0.62 annualized dividend and a yield of 3.7%. Huntington Bancshares’s dividend payout ratio (DPR) is presently 47.69%.

Huntington Bancshares Profile

(Free Report)

Huntington Bancshares Incorporated (NASDAQ: HBAN) is a bank holding company headquartered in Columbus, Ohio, that provides a broad range of banking and financial services through its principal subsidiary, Huntington National Bank. The company’s operations are centered on retail and commercial banking, and it serves individual consumers, small and middle-market businesses, and institutional customers.

Huntington’s product offerings include traditional deposit and lending products, consumer and commercial loans, mortgage origination and servicing, auto financing, and business banking solutions.
